 Human-Centric Health: Behaviour Change and the Prevention of NonCommunicable Diseases

Decreasing the effect of NCDs requires a more systematic response. This report describes how a human-centric health ecosystem (HCHE) can bring together stakeholders from the public and private sectors and create a context for cooperation to achieve shared goals: reducing the risks that bring about and worsen NCDs; providing efficient and effective care for disease sufferers; and thereby improving well-being across the globe.

Report by the World Economic Forum
